FAW Hongqi says its ultra-fast battery charges 10%-70% in 3 minutes 41 seconds

China FAW Group’s Hongqi brand said its newly developed ultra-fast charging battery can go from 10% to 70% in 3 minutes and 41 seconds. If it reaches mass production, that would be faster than BYD‘s (HKEX: 1211) second-generation Blade Battery.

The battery, developed in-house by the Hongqi brand together with China Automotive New Energy Battery Technology (CNET), recently completed charging performance tests at 25 C, according to a statement on Tuesday.

Test data showed the battery needs just 3 minutes and 41 seconds to charge from 10% to 70% SOC (state of charge), and 8 minutes and 3 seconds to go from 10% to 97% SOC, figures that lead the industry, Hongqi said.

Hongqi didn’t mention a mass production timeline for the battery, nor which model would be the first to carry it. BYD’s second-generation Blade Battery and flash charging technology are already available in a large number of models.

The battery features a highly efficient ultra-fast charging anode that breaks through the charging rate bottleneck of cells, allowing a peak charging rate of 12C, Hongqi said.

The brand also developed its own electrolyte with low desolvation energy to lower the barrier to lithium-ion migration.

Using composite carbon source coating plus bulk-phase doping modification technology, the cell’s internal resistance is 15% lower than that of comparable cells, improving charge transfer efficiency and charging response speed, Hongqi said.
